https://bugs.documentfoundation.org/show_bug.cgi?id=151579 --- Comment #7 from fenug...@users.sourceforge.net --- Probably dupe of 134370 . See my comments there; I suggest trying a different 'SAL_USE_VCLPLUGIN' env setting. I had similar issues and that was a workaround. -- You are receiving this mail because: You are the assignee for the bug.
